Heavy rain is the number one enemy of a dry basement. Water damage not only ruins stored possessions and finished living spaces but can also lead to costly structural repairs and unhealthy mold growth. Protecting your basement requires a multi-faceted approach, focusing on managing water outside your home and sealing vulnerabilities inside.

1. Exterior Water Diversion (First Line of Defense)

The most effective way to prevent basement flooding is to ensure rainwater never pools near your foundation.

A. Gutters and Downspouts

  • Clean Regularly: Clogged gutters are a primary cause of water damage, forcing water to spill over and pool right next to the foundation. Clean them at least twice a year.
  • Extend Downspouts: Downspouts must discharge water at least 5 to 10 feet away from the foundation. Use extensions or splash blocks to ensure runoff is directed to a sloped area of the lawn.

Gutter maintenance is a critical, yet often overlooked, chore for homeowners. A clean and functional gutter system is essential for diverting water away from your home’s roof, fascia, walls, and foundation, preventing costly water damage, leaks, and even basement flooding.

While the ideal frequency for cleaning depends on your property’s surroundings (especially the number of nearby trees), a general rule is to perform a thorough cleaning and inspection at least twice a year: in the late spring and late fall.

Here is your comprehensive step-by-step guide for seasonal gutter cleaning and inspection.

Preparation: Safety and Tools

Before climbing the ladder, prioritize safety and gather all necessary equipment.

Safety First

  • Stable Ladder: Use a sturdy extension ladder that is tall enough to safely reach your gutters without overreaching. A ladder stabilizer or standoff arm is highly recommended to protect your gutters and increase stability.

Your home’s HVAC system is the lungs of your house, and the air filter is its first line of defense. While many homeowners follow a seasonal or quarterly replacement schedule, adopting a monthly HVAC filter replacement schedule—especially for standard 1-inch filters—is the single most effective, simple maintenance task you can perform to dramatically improve your indoor air quality and safeguard your entire heating and cooling system.

In a world where indoor air can be two to five times more polluted than outdoor air, a commitment to a 30-day filter change provides immediate and long-term benefits for your health, comfort, and wallet.
